gvawatermark ============ Overlays the metadata on the video frame to visualize the inference results. .. code-block:: none Pad Templates: SINK template: 'sink' Availability: Always Capabilities: video/x-raw format: { (string)BGRx, (string)BGRA, (string)BGR, (string)NV12, (string)I420 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] video/x-raw(memory:DMABuf) format: { (string)RGBA, (string)I420 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] video/x-raw(memory:VASurface) format: { (string)NV12 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] SRC template: 'src' Availability: Always Capabilities: video/x-raw format: { (string)BGRx, (string)BGRA, (string)BGR, (string)NV12, (string)I420 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] video/x-raw(memory:DMABuf) format: { (string)RGBA, (string)I420 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] video/x-raw(memory:VASurface) format: { (string)NV12 } width: [ 1, 2147483647 ] height: [ 1, 2147483647 ] framerate: [ 0/1, 2147483647/1 ] Element has no clocking capabilities. Element has no URI handling capabilities. Pads: SINK: 'sink' Pad Template: 'sink' SRC: 'src' Pad Template: 'src' Element Properties: async-handling : The bin will handle Asynchronous state changes flags: readable, writable Boolean. Default: false device : Supported devices are CPU and GPU. Default is CPU on system memory and GPU on video memory flags: readable, writable String. Default: null message-forward : Forwards all children messages flags: readable, writable Boolean. Default: false name : The name of the object flags: readable, writable String. Default: "gvawatermark0" parent : The parent of the object flags: readable, writable Object of type "GstObject"
